The M.Sc. (Medical) Anatomy is a specialized postgraduate program designed for students aiming to build a deep understanding of human anatomy and its clinical applications. The program blends traditional anatomy with modern technological advancements, emphasizing the application of anatomical knowledge in healthcare.

This program offers an in-depth exploration of human anatomy, blending theoretical knowledge with hands-on learning through cadaver dissections and advanced imaging techniques like MRI and CT scans. With a strong emphasis on integrating anatomical studies with clinical practice, students gain practical exposure to real-world medical scenarios. The program also fosters research and innovation, equipping students with the skills to contribute to advancements in anatomical sciences.

Eligibility Criteria

  1. A Bachelor’s degree in Life Sciences, Biological Sciences, Medicine, Physiotherapy, or a related field from a recognized institution.
  2. A minimum of 50% aggregate marks or equivalent in the qualifying degree.
